Does Century Financial Charge Deposit Fees?

Century Financial charges deposit fees for certain methods. Specifically, credit card deposits incur a fee of 1%–3%. However, all other methods, such as bank transfers and e-wallets, are free of charge. Overall, their fee policy is transparent but may be considered relatively high for credit card transactions.

Does Century Financial Support Cryptos to Deposit?

Century Financial does not support cryptocurrency deposits; only fiat currency deposits are accepted. This limitation may not appeal to users looking to trade digital assets, as traditional payment methods predominantly dominate their offerings.

How to Withdraw from Century Financial

  1. Log into Your Account: Access your Century Financial account by entering your credentials on the broker’s website.
  2. Navigate to the Withdrawal Section: Once logged in, go to the ‘Funds’ or ‘Withdrawal’ section, typically found in your account dashboard.
  3. Select Your Withdrawal Method: Choose your preferred withdrawal method from the available options (e.g., bank transfer, credit card). Ensure that the method matches your deposit method for seamless processing.
  4. Enter Withdrawal Amount: Specify the amount you wish to withdraw, keeping in mind any minimum or maximum limits set by the broker.
  5. Confirm and Submit Your Request: Review the details of your withdrawal request, ensuring accuracy, and then confirm to submit your withdrawal request. You will receive a confirmation notification once processed.
